727587"
Yes it matters!!
You need to use "config" (twice).

30CTE06 = CICS 6.1 SIP so you have the following:
S - Standard (means up to 8 lines & 16 phones)
I - IRAD
P - Prompts (built-in small version of AA with CCR)

So use the correct password then: System Programming/Remote Access/IRAD - Press Clear

Even with the IRAD disabled (from SP instead of SIP) the IRAD will answer. The only thing it will let you do though, is add a license code to enable the IRAD.
